CHARLES AUGUSTUS HAMILTON. Lawyer, associated with the firm ofSmith. Gage & Dresser, was born July 15, 1877, in Worcester, a son of James Pres-cott and Sarah Antoinette (Kimball) Hamilton. He attended the public schoolsof this city and graduated from the Classical High School in 1895. He enteredHarvard College, from which he graduated in 1899 with the degree of Bachelorof Arts. He read law in the office of Charles M. Thayer, was admitted to the barin 1902, and since then has been practicing law in this city. He remained in theoffice of Mr. Thayer for six years, and afterward practiced alone for four the past five years he has been associated with the law firm of Smith, Gage& Dresser.
